Pro-Israel narrative

The strikes represent a necessary and proportionate response to protect Israeli civilians from Houthi aggression. The targeted facilities were being used as central hubs for transferring weapons and operatives, enabling terrorist activities against Israel. The precision strikes, preceded by civilian evacuation warnings, demonstrate Israel's commitment to minimizing civilian casualties while defending its territory.

Anti-Israel narrative

The Israeli attacks constitute an unjustified aggression against Yemen's civilian infrastructure, causing widespread destruction and humanitarian impact. The strikes on airports, ports, and factories primarily affect ordinary Yemenis, destroying vital facilities and threatening thousands of jobs. These attacks represent collective punishment and will only escalate regional tensions while failing to deter support for Palestinians in Gaza.
